Enhanced Data Accuracy



Using a modern-day rainfall gauge significantly boosts the precision and reliability of data gathered on rainfall levels. Conventional rainfall evaluates typically face limitations such as evaporation losses, wind results, and manual reading errors, resulting in incorrect data. On the other hand, contemporary rainfall evaluates are equipped with sophisticated modern technologies like ultrasonic sensors, tipping buckets, or considering mechanisms that provide more exact and real-time data on rainfall strength and duration.




The enhanced data precision used by modern-day rain gauges is vital for different applications, including flooding forecasting, water resource monitoring, agriculture, and metropolitan preparation. By specifically gauging rainfall patterns, these gauges allow researchers and meteorologists to much better recognize regional climate condition and fads, bring about even more reputable forecasts and early caution systems for extreme weather condition events.


Moreover, the data gathered from modern rainfall gauges can be conveniently integrated into climate monitoring networks and analyzed using innovative software, boosting the general accuracy and performance of rainfall information analysis. On the whole, making use of modern-day rainfall determines plays a vital duty in enhancing the high quality of weather-related data for a variety of functional objectives.

Effective Resource Planning



Efficient source preparation is essential for making the most of and maximizing procedures effectiveness in numerous markets. Modern rain evaluates play an essential duty in enhancing source planning by supplying real-time and exact information on precipitation levels. By utilizing information accumulated from these advanced rainfall gauges, organizations and organizations can make enlightened decisions pertaining to source allowance, particularly in markets heavily impacted by climate condition such as farming, transport, and building and construction.


In agriculture, for instance, having accessibility to accurate rains measurements permits farmers to plan irrigation timetables better, making sure that plants receive sufficient water without wastefulness. In building and construction, recognizing the specific amount linked here of rains can aid task managers change timelines and assign sources accordingly to prevent delays and expense overruns. In the transport market, precise rains data allows authorities to execute positive measures to prevent flooding, lower traffic congestion, and guarantee the safety and security of travelers.

Advanced Technology Combination



With the rapid improvements in modern see technology, the assimilation of contemporary rainfall determines has transformed the means rainfall information is accumulated and utilized for different objectives. Advanced innovation assimilation in rainfall determines involves the incorporation of sensing units that can detect not only the amount of rains however additionally the strength and duration of rainfall occasions. These sensors can supply real-time data, enabling more accurate weather surveillance and projecting.
